Output f231cc8dfb0caa83133a782d567a6cdaf67b1f69fc9b2420b0b7ba846e6c633a:4

value
1937769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d17a94a7eb0e202af97686fdc28a2e48cd51c9e3 OP_EQUAL
address
3Lndzh5P6MZpxN3Ex2aKtKy7D1huEAfW6A
transaction
f231cc8dfb0caa83133a782d567a6cdaf67b1f69fc9b2420b0b7ba846e6c633a
confirmations
384431
spent
true